Panel Aluminium Fabrication Techniques Explained

Panel alloy creation encompasses several processes to shape durable components. Common techniques include curving, dividing, and welding. Bending utilizes dedicated tools to create complex shapes, often requiring precise calculations for correct outcomes. Cutting, frequently conducted by CNC saws or lasers, provides precise edges. Fusing, when needed, typically employs Gas Tungsten Arc or Gas Metal Arc methods to establish strong joints between sections. Each method demands experienced personnel and suitable machinery for best quality.

Panel Construction: Fire Resistance and Performance

Regarding it comes to building security, aluminium fabrication offer a substantial advantage. Such products are inherently non-combustible and demonstrate superior functionality in fire events. Usually, aluminum panels will not contribute to a conflagration's growth, aiding to safeguard people and minimize property loss. Moreover, various panel redirected here structures satisfy demanding fire testing and comply with severe regulatory codes, confirming a safe level of fire protection.

Aluminum Care and Washing Advice

To maintain your panel cladding remains its best and performs properly , periodic maintenance is vital . Initiate with a gentle washing using lukewarm water and a soft brush . Avoid abrasive chemicals , as these can damage the coating . From time to time examine for any evidence of damage , such as scratches , and repair them promptly . A basic sprinkler can often work for routine upkeep.
